Rachida Dati Mourns Loss of Aunt in Heartfelt Instagram Tribute
Rachida Dati announced on her Instagram account on Monday the tragic passing of a member of her family.
"My Aunt, the sister of Dad who loved him so much, joined him tonight. Peace to their souls as well as to Mom. A life of struggles, trials in the silence of dignity. May God grant him His infinite Mercy and gather them together," Rachida Dati wrote on her Instagram account, in the caption of two black and white photos. In one of the photos, taken in Casablanca, Morocco, she is seen next to a woman, probably the deceased aunt.
Of Moroccan father (M’Barek Dati) and Algerian mother (Fatima-Zohra), Rachida Dati remains very attached to her roots. The LR mayor of the 7th arrondissement of Paris, who grew up in Chalon-sur-Saône with her six sisters and four brothers, holds on to the values transmitted by her parents who no longer live. "Daughter of M’Barek and Fatim-Zohra. Minister of Justice," is also the title of her autobiographical book published in 2011.
Her father, M’Barek, died in Paris in 2017, from chronic illnesses. Her mother, on the other hand, died about fifteen years earlier, in 2001. Rachida Dati wanted to pay tribute to her by giving her daughter the name Zohra.
